| Jeffrey S. Callico has written poetry and fiction since 1981. He edited Negative Suck, an online literary magazine, from 2009 to 2014. Although it is now defunct, he himself is not. His previous publications include Fighting Off The Sun: Stories, Tales, and Other Matters of Opinion, and chapbooks Early Trouble, Ceilings, Rough Travel, The Well-Dressed Drunk, People = Bus, and most recently Semantics. |
